With new first baseman Spencer Horwitz already out 6 to 8 weeks following wrist surgery, the Pirates plan to use internal options before looking at a trade or free agency to fill the gap. They’ve got experienced first basemen in camp, with Billy Cook, Darick Hall, Enmanuel Valdez, and JC Stewart. They also have Jared Triolo, who can play anywhere in the infield, and some minor league options.
Spring Training kicked off yesterday with pitchers and catchers having their first workout, although most of the position players are already in camp. Manager Derek Shelton says he has more talent in Bradenton than he’s ever had.
Bryan Reynolds has experimented with playing first base, but Shelton says Reynolds will focus on a different type of position switch.
Shelton is looking forward to the effect that veteran Tommy Pham will have on the team, with his bat and glove, and in the clubhouse.

One of the biggest free agents of the offseason finally found a new hoe last night. The Red Sox will sign former Astros third baseman Alex Bregman for three years at $120 million, with two opt-outs. Bregman has played his entire 9-year career in Houston.
